This specific site usually had weekly spiderings / updates yet it has 60+ new pages none of which have yet even to be spidered plus many of the existing pages which have also been updated are yet to show this.

Obviously, until spidered it won't show any updates. What i'm trying to establish is whether it's still spidering at its normal frequency. If it is, and then due to revisit, we can move onto the next step which is reflecting the updates/changes.
If it's not been spidered you might need to send it some signals. eg, make sure the sitemap is suitable updated, or add a link elsewhere that will attract gbot so that the new pages can be discovered.

The results was the #1 result was the reference on my sitemap

Meaning your sitemap.xml file appears in the search results?

I've seen that before but usually there's an issue with the sitemap file, e.g. it's not marked up correctly, the content-type is incorrect, etc. And make sure you're not linking to your sitemap file from anywhere on your site except maybe robots.txt.
